How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fair Oaks?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fair Oaks Studio Apartments | $1,471 | $1,250 | $1,901 |
| Fair Oaks 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,695 | $1,245 | $2,385 |
| Fair Oaks 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,000 | $1,400 | $3,075 |
Fair Oaks 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,540 | $2,000 | $3,465 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Fair Oaks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Fair Oaks with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Fair Oaks is at Greenback Terrace Apartments listed at $2,525.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Fair Oaks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Fair Oaks is $2,540.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Fair Oaks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Fair Oaks is a 1,300 square feet unit starting from $2,525 at Greenback Terrace Apartments.
